The upcoming 2024 election is unlike any other in American history. The stakes seem higher, and the implications for democracy, our country, diversity, equity, and inclusion (DEI) are unprecedented. Join us as our knowledgeable panel dives into our unique challenges and how Project 2025 and the anti-DEI attacks might play a crucial role in dismantling DEI and shaping our future.

This webinar, featuring moderator Effenus Henderson and a panel of experts from the legal, DEI  and small business sectors, will discuss the impact of the 2024 election on DEI initiatives in small, medium and large organizations. Our panelists will also take a realistic look at the most critical implications of Project 2025 for DEI from a few different perspectives, and focus on strategies for navigating the unknown challenges we may face.

Our September session will be closely linked to our October webinar: The High Stakes 2024 Election-Part II: How Do We Respond?
